Visual Structure & Adult ADHD with Sara Olsher of Mighty + Bright
Manage episode 427294691 series 2789083
In this episode of The Adulting with ADHD Podcast, I am thrilled to welcome Sara Olsher, Founder and CEO of Mighty + Bright (aff). Sara shares her journey of creating visual schedules to help her daughter cope with anxiety and how this led to developing tools that assist both children and adults with ADHD. Discover how visual charts can simplify daily tasks, improve communication and enhance productivity for neurodivergent individuals.
HighlightsSara's personal journey and the inspiration behind Mighty + Bright
The benefits of visual schedules for people with ADHD
How visual charts work and their advantages over digital tools
The impact of Sara’s products
Tips on getting started with visual charts
Collaborations with mental health experts like KC Davis and Mr. Chazz
Upcoming projects, including tools for elder care and memory care
"Sometimes digital is not actually as good as analog for a variety of reasons, including the dopamine rush from physically checking things off a to-do list."
"The mental labor that goes into creating a to-do list can be overwhelming."
